>> Our hardware supports RAS(Reliability, Availability, Serviceability) by
>> exposing a set of error counters which can be used by observability
>> tools to take corrective actions or repairs. Traditionally there were
>> being exposed via PMU (for relative counters) and sysfs interface (for
>> absolute value) in our internal branch. But, due to the limitations in
>> this approach to use two interfaces and also not able to have an event
>> based reporting or configurability, an alternative approach to try
>> netlink was suggested by community for drm subsystem wide UAPI for RAS
>> and telemetry as discussed in [1].
>>
>> This [1] is the inspiration to this series. It uses the generic
>> netlink(genl) family subsystem and exposes a set of commands that can
>> be used by every drm driver, the framework provides a means to have
>> custom commands too. Each drm driver instance in this example xe driver
>> instance registers a family and operations to the genl subsystem through
>> which it enumerates and reports the error counters. An event based
>> notification is also supported to which userpace can subscribe to and
>> be notified when any error occurs and read the error counter this avoids
>> continuous polling on error counter. This can also be extended to
>> threshold based notification.

> The habanalabs driver is another candidate to use this netlink-based drm 
> framework.
> As a single-user device, we have an additional "control" device that 
> allows multiple applications to query for information and to monitor the 
> "compute" device.
> And while we are about to move the compute device to the accel nodes, we 
> don't have a real replacement there for the control device.
> 
> Another possible usage of this framework for habanalabs is the events 
> notification.
> Currently we have an eventfd-based mechanism, and after being notified 
> about an event, user starts querying about the event and the relevant 
> info, usually in several requests.
> With this framework we should be allegedly possible to gather all 
> relevant info together with the event itself.

that is right with the multicast event we can pack data too.
> 
> The current implementation seems intended more to errors (and quite 
> "tailored" to Xe needs ...), while in habanalabs we would need it also 
> for non-error static/dynamic info.
> Maybe we should revise the existing commands/attributes to be more generic?

correct, at present that is the usecase xe driver has and atleast for
the error part I believe is generic if not we can make it, the framework
is extensible. The idea I had was generic commands which every driver
can use will be part of drm framework and if there are specific commands
or attributes that shall be part of driver. But some thought is needed
here as MAX attributes is needed by userspace and how to define
attribute policy etc..,

> 
> Moreover, the drm part is very small, while most of the netlink "mess" 
> is still done by the specific driver.
> So what is the added value in making it a "drm framework"? Do we enforce 
> something here for drm drivers that use it? Do we help them with simpler 
> APIs and hiding the internals of netlink?> Maybe it would be worth moving some functionality from the Xe driver
> into drm helpers?

your suggestion sounds good and interesting but it might need some
analysis like if we move the registration parts to drm framework how
would we register the driver private commands and attributes if there
are any. But ya having most of the part at drm level helps all the
driver. I'll do some analysis and i'll come back on this.
